Cable composition of propylene - ethylene block copolymer resistant to copper ions
Block copolymer 02 - MK
Application area:
The composition is intended for production by extrusion of cable and wire insulation, resistant to high ambient temperatures and copper, which is resistant to petroleum products.
Brief information about the composition:
Composition 02 - MK is made on the basis of a propylene - ethylene block copolymer with the introduction of special additives that improve the thermal stability of the composition in the presence of copper ions.
